3α-Hydroxysteroid Dehydrogenase, Microorganism
Synonym(s): 3α-HSD
- CAS No.: 9028-56-2
- Formula:N/A
- Molecular Weight:N/A
SMILES: [3a-Hydroxysteroid Dehydrogenase, Microorganism]
Biological Activity: 3α-Hydroxysteroid Dehydrogenase, Microorganism (3α-HSD) is an enzyme encoded by the AKR1C4 gene, which can catalyze the conversion of 3-ketosteroids into 3α-hydroxy compounds. 3α-Hydroxysteroid dehydrogenase plays an important role in the inactivation of androgen DHT, and can convert DHT into 3α-androstanediol with weak androgen activity, which can be used in the research of hirsutism[1].
